Quinn A. Clark


Quinn A. Clark is a doctoral candidate in the Religion Department of Columbia University in New York City, NY. He is currently based in Lucknow carrying out research on a Fulbright-Nehru research grant. His research examines Muslim saint shrines and the politics of ziyarāt (visitation) in the Lucknow metro area. As a work of historical ethnography, his dissertation attempts to trace historically the roots of the political and theological debates surrounding shrines and to understand anthropologically how these debates shape the symbolic status of these places as they are used to satisfy everyday needs.”
